Transaction 578b817231a03e5a6d13d6d2709283b59875fe60a142035eb47494cb338cc6e0
1 Input
1 Output
-
578b817231a03e5a6d13d6d2709283b59875fe60a142035eb47494cb338cc6e0:0
- value
- 194102
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18c1b27dfb4ddca0dacdc9031606a402f211e4e8 OP_EQUAL
- address
- 33wvBU4vVkxrc6TqV4LBf7c62wx6aXRacx